The fifth grade scores are mixed as follows:

The mixed operation of addition and subtraction of grades in grade five refers to the addition and subtraction of grades in the calculation process. This kind of operation needs to pay attention to some special skills and laws.

Here are some key points and steps that can help you solve the problem of five-level fractional mixing operation:

First, make sure that all fractions have the same denominator. If the denominators are different, you need to find their common denominators and convert them first. For example, if there are two fractions with denominators of 3 and 4 respectively, their denominators can be changed to 12 to facilitate calculation.

Second, add and subtract, and perform corresponding operations on molecules. Increase or decrease the numerator of the fraction and keep the denominator unchanged.

Third, if possible, simplify the results. Simplify the result to the simplest form, that is, the numerator and denominator are divided by their greatest common divisor.

Fourth, if necessary, convert the results into fractions or mixed numbers. This is a representation that converts the result into an integer and a true fraction. If the numerator is greater than or equal to the denominator, you can take out the integer part and take the rest as the true fraction.

Fifth, check whether the answer is reasonable. It can be verified by estimation or calculator to ensure that the answer is correct in value.

The following is an answer to a sample question:

Question: Calculate the result of the following fractional mixed operation: 3/4+ 1/2- 1/8.

Answer: First, we need to make sure that the denominators of the scores are the same. Convert 3/4 and 1/2 into fractions with denominator of 8, and get 6/8+ 4/8- 1/8.

Then add: 6/8+4/8-1/8 =10/8-1/8.

Then, simplify the result: 10/8- 1/8=9/8.

Finally, we can convert the results into component numbers: 9/8= 1 and 1/8.

Therefore, 3/4+1/2-1/8 =1and1/8.
